Artemis' Diary

Describe the most famous pieces of art in your world. What made them so famous?

The most famous piece of art in the Templon system is likely Artemis' diary, describing every day of Artemis' life both divine and regular. The book has five chapters currently, with more being added at a distance of about five hundred years. Though, the series is ever so popular despite the intervals between releases.  

The Books themselves

  The first book has a green sleeve with golden binders, with a golden laurel on the front. Titled "Beginning" The second book has a blue sleeve with silver binders, with a doublecross on the front. Titled "Faith" The third book has a red sleeve with bronze binders, with a fire on the front. Titled "Death" The fourth book has a white sleeve with silver binders, with a candle on the front. Titled "Rebirth" The fifth book dark green sleeve with golden binders, with a laurel and doublecross on the front. Titled "Shenanigans"  

Beginning

  The first book describes Artemis' life before he was a hierophant, and ends just after he confronts the high-priest. The most famous excerpt can be found below:   "The old bastard thinks he can get away with blatant abusing of power in the church, and i'm gonna prove him wrong. If i don't add anymore to this you know what happened"  

Faith

  The second book chronicles the Hierophant-hood of Artemis, it ends after he marries Jadwiga. The most famous excerpt can be found below:   "I met the leader of Fabia today and if I have to be totally honest. I'm completely enchanted by her though, I don't know if I should do something about it. Seeing as I nearly just lost Eliza, i'll think about this all night probably.  

Death

  The third book documents the late life and early sainthood of Artemis, it ends after the third impact. The most famous excerpt can be found beneath:   "I spotted a huge comet heading towards Tempertaria, Gemipurity is worried. The other gods suspect the third impact is upon us, let's hope it's like the second one."  

Rebirth

  The fourth novel portrays the Fights of the fall of Tempertaria from Artemis' perspective, as one could imagine it's mostly Artemis crying over the things he experienced down there.   "I couldn't see her but, I knew she was suffering."    

Shenanigans

    The fifth book depicts the tomfoolery of Artemis throughout his late to current sainthood, it ends after the events of "Olive Blood"   "The gal was blushing brighter than the sun, she's into me I know it."

Purpose

The Book originally was just to document Artemis' private life though, after he wrote the second book he submitted the two for publishing.
